Naga Chaitanya And Director Chandu Mondeti Gear Up For New Project After Thandel Success

Following the success of Thandel, Naga Chaitanya and director Chandu Mondeti are preparing for their next collaboration. The director shared these exciting details during the Thandel success event.

“Nagarjuna sir, I can feel your happiness about Chaitanya’s success. But we (addressing the fans) are even more thrilled than you. This is just the beginning; from now on, it’s nothing but hits. No one understood the story of Thandel like music director Devi Sri Prasad did. His music brought the story to life. Additionally, editor Naveen Nooli trusted me greatly with this project. Just as we emotionally connected with the story, the audience did as well. After Savyasachi, producer Bunny Vasu gave me the opportunity to direct this film. I also see many qualities in Allu Aravind garu that I admire. Sobhita (Naga Chaitanya’s wife), your fluency in Telugu is impressive. Please pass that skill on to our hero. We are planning a historical film in the future, where we will be reimagining Tenali Ramakrishna, originally acted by Akkineni Nageswara Rao, for today’s audience. Nageswara Rao’s iconic acting will be carried forward by Naga Chaitanya. We all look forward to it,” the director shared.
